Ruud ter Meulen
My name is Ruud ter Meulen, and I am Professor and Director of the Centre for Ethics in Medicine of the University of Bristol, Before my appointment in Bristol I was Director of the Institute of Bioethics in Maastricht and Profesor at the University of Maastricht. Profile: I am particularly interested in justice in health care, ethics of new biotechnologies, human enhancement, the ethics of research, care of older people, and evidence-based medicine. I have co-ordinated several international research projects in the field of bioethics, many of them funded in the various framework programs of the European Commission. I was co-ordinator of the EPOCH project on the role of ethics in public policy regarding new biotechnologies and of the SYBHEL project on ethical, legal and social issues of synthetic biology as applied to health. My role in SYNERGENE is to support the activities of the Centre for Public Engagement of our University in Area 2 and to collaborate with the other partners on ethical, social and legal issues regarding synthetic biology.
